Output e155709c026400a754ac6ae4a5d5c44c81ab6158e9c36f2baa75b366a0367b90:1

value
940242977
script pubkey
OP_0 OP_PUSHBYTES_20 3f6a0a21bb0d2893c2e135fd656543f1bfafba4d
address
ltc1q8a4q5gdmp55f8shpxh7k2e2r7xl6lwjdurkqht
transaction
e155709c026400a754ac6ae4a5d5c44c81ab6158e9c36f2baa75b366a0367b90
spent
true